The Patient & Public Involvement in Health Forum covering Cotswold & Vale is holding their next meeting in public on 21st July. The forum would welcome members of the public and representatives from community and voluntary organisations to attend their meeting to raise any concerns they may have on any health related issues and about recent hospital experiences which went well.
The Forum will be discussing and agreeing some of the generic health issues which will form part of their work plan for 2005/06 and to this end would welcome attendance from patients, public, careers and voluntary and community organisations to bring to the Forum's attention any issues of concern they would wish the Forum to consider. What are your views on the long term usage of your Community Hospitals? Are your local dentists de-registering children from their NHS lists? Senior managers from Cotswold & Vale Primary Care Trust will be in attendance at the meeting to help answer any questions raised. Staff from the Patient Advice and Liaison Service and the Independent Complaints Advocacy Service also try to be present to address any personal issues.
